Personality: A strange and disturbing man, Jervis Tetch is a highly delusional psychopath. Now not to say he is on par with the more aggressive types of the Joker, Killer Croc, or even Scarecrow, his psychosis is more...odd. For the most part the Hatter presents himself as clueless and detached from reality. Often acting seemingly harmless as he is self-absorbed into his own little world. This is apparent by speaking with the loon, as he speaks in riddles and nonsensical babble. Stringing together words and sentences and pretending as if he makes perfect sense. Giggly and easily amused, the diminutive man acts like a child.

Although he acts childish and aloof, it isn't wise to underestimate him. Make no doubt, Jervis is incredibly dangerous and can be surprisingly strong and lash out quite violently when the mood takes him. Not to say Jervis suffers from mood swings, he's just capable of making an easy shift into rage. Besides acting goofy, Jervis is a sick minded individual. He likes to toy with people's minds in a pursuit to break their will, and have them accept they are living in a "Wonderland." He doesn't see human life as something precious, more like a gadget to tinker with. There is no point in life, it's all just randomness and Jervis believes this. Hence his fixation on the works of Lewis Carroll which is filled with absurdities.

Absurd is the key word to describe the Hatter. Plagued with various neurotics, it's hard to tell sometimes if Jervis is truly insane or faking it. This is called into question because of the level of intellect Jervis possesses. He is a brilliant neuro-scientist and technician, capable of creating hypnotic devices and psychedelic drugs, all in order to make the mind malleable. Before completely absorbing himself into his delusions, he had very little regard for humanity and the concept of free will. Believing that the mind is the weakest part of the human body. Despite being a nut case he does continue try and prove his theories correct, just in a more confusing and unorthodox way.

As mentioned Jervis has various neurotics, many of them hat related. He has an intense obsession with hats and head wear. Having an uncontrollable urge to find unique and interesting versions of this article of clothing. Even more strange is the Hatter's refusal to eat anything without a hat on it. This obsession likely stems from his father, who was the owner of a Hatter and Haberdashery, coupled with the Carroll character The Mad Hatter, who always wears a top hat. His intense love for hats is very deep, to the point that he claims he has headaches if he isn't wearing his beloved hat. He is also known to have an extreme attachment to the hat, even valuing it more so than human life. He also has an obsession with tea, as he always observes Afternoon Tea. Though he isn't limited to tea time, he drinks the beverage at any time of day, breakfast, lunch, and dinner, it's always tea. It is believed the Hatter has an addiction to tea, likely addicted to the caffeine found in tea. He drinks it to comfort him, and the worse he feels threatened, the more quickly he consumes the drink. His reaction towards tea is equatable to an alcoholic. It's a theory his headaches do not stem from the separation of his hat, but rather a withdrawal from not drinking tea. Then there comes his obsession with women, particularly blondes with blue eyes. This is because Alice is described as a blonde with blue eyes, the type of description Hatter seeks when abducting women. It is known he mentally tortures women, trying to rewire their brain into believing they're "Alice." Though the most persistent of all is the fascination with Lewis Carroll's books. Jervis truly believes he is the Mad Hatter and stages many of his crimes on these literary works.

Personal History:

Early Years

Jervis was born to Mordecai and Eliza Tetch in a low income area of Gotham City. Mordecai was the owner of a very unsuccessful "Hatter and Haberdashery," a clothing retail store. While Eliza was a housewife. The couple constantly faced economic issues. Still the ever hopeful, Mordecai was determined to keep his business afloat and to accomplish this he taught his son at an young age how to tailor. This was all tactical, grooming the young Jervis to take over the shop when he was older. The issue of the matter was his father was too overbearing and critical of Jervis. Then one night Mordecai struck Jervis in a drunken rage over a simple mistake. Eliza was very coddling of Jervis and very protective of the boy, immediately stepping in and ending their training sessions. While Eliza spared Jervis more trouble, she didn't fail to press her own ambitions as well.

Eliza wanted Jervis to be educated with her hope that Jervis will avoid the hard life they live. She heavily believes the only way Jervis will live a happy and successful life is to have a complete education. In order to do so, she exposed Jervis to stimulating and educational pastimes. The most successful of which was reading classic literature before he went to bed. Eliza read to him the works of such authors as W.B. Yeats, Jules Verne, Mark Twain, Charles Dickens, H.G. Wells, but his most favorite was Lewis Carroll. Every night Jervis would ask to be read Alice's Adventures in Wonderland and Through the Looking Glass. His mother, the pleaser she was, always conceded

Despite having an alcoholic father and having less than other children, life wasn't so bad. This would all change however, when Mordecai's business went under. After he lost his business they couldn't keep payments on the house and eventually went bankrupt. In order to avoid living out in the streets his mother managed to secure them a room at a boarding house. Their landlord was a strict woman named Ella Littleton, who had deep fundamentalist views. The living conditions were not as high as their previous home. Sometimes the nights were too cold and the days too hot. Still basic water, electricity, and gas worked. The only silver lining for Jervis was the landlord's daughter, Connie Littleton. She was the spitting image of Carroll's Alice. Having recognized this he naturally gravitated towards her.

Tetch never had a friend in his life. He was always socially awkward and the other kids made fun of his teeth and oddly shaped head. This was made even worse when it became apparent that his growth was stunted. Connie on the other hand was a kind, gentle soul who never made fun of Jervis. Jervis was actually very charming to the young girl. They soon developed a strong friendship, one that Connie's mother didn't disprove of, which was something difficult at the time. She normally didn't have Connie hang out with other boys for fear of sexual deviancy. Yet seeing Tetch's appearance and low opinion of himself, she felt she had little to worry. It's hard to say if Connie was the one thing prolonging Tetch's descent into madness, if the two had not been friends would he have turned out so wrong? What is for certain is that because of her, Jervis spiraled down into his madness.
